toss

英[t?s]
美[t??s]

基本释义

  • vt.& vi.扔‖,抛; (使)摇荡; 摇匀; 掷硬币决定
  • n.掷硬币决定; 向上甩头; 猛仰头(尤指表示恼怒或不耐烦); (尤指比赛或游戏中)投掷

英英释义

Noun
  • 1. the act of flipping a coin

  • 2. (sports) the act of throwing the ball to another member of your team;

    "the pass was fumbled"

  • 3. an abrupt movement;

    "a toss of his head"

Verb
  • 1. throw or toss with a light motion;

    "flip me the beachball"

    "toss me newspaper"

  • 2. lightly throw to see which side comes up;

    "I don't know what to do--I may as well flip a coin!"

  • 3. throw carelessly;

    "chuck the ball"

  • 4. move or stir about violently;

    "The feverish patient thrashed around in his bed"

  • 5. throw or cast away;

    "Put away your worries"

  • 6. agitate;

    "toss the salad"
